Back Ruia group recruiting senior execs for Dunlop Pratim Ranjan Bose
Kolkata, Jan. 15 WORKING for the quick reopening of Dunlop India Ltd, the Ruia Group is currently busy recruiting senior-level marketing, management and production personnel. Already, the company has appointed more than 15 executives and is in the process of taking in 35 to 40 more soon. According to sources, a few candidates were also short-listed for the CEO's job as well as those of production heads at both the Sahagunj and Ambattur facilities. "We will be recruiting a total of roughly 60 senior executives latest by next week," a company official said. The company is also re-opening and streamlining its administration as well as marketing establishments in various metros and other important locations. Discussions have also started with dealers. Tyre industry sources said the company is now targeting executives with experience in marketing truck and bus tyres for heading various zones. The company is reportedly zeroing in on truck and bus tyres to start with. Meanwhile, Dunlop is expecting to finalise the labour agreement at Sahagunj facility shortly. "We have assessed the total labour dues at over Rs 35 crore and propose to settle part of the same through deferred payment. The proposal is now being scrutinised by the trade unions. We expect to arrive at a conclusion shortly," an official said. Discussions are also on with various funding agencies in India and abroad for financing modernisation of both the facilities. "We have already prepared a plan for modernisation and re-opening of the facilities which will be taken up with operating agency SBI at the next meeting of BIFR on January 16," the official said.
